The Princess of Wales Hospital is a district general hospital within the Abertawe Bro Morgannwg University Health Board. Opened in 1985, the hospital is located on the outskirts of Bridgend and provides modern, purpose-built accommodation for the provision of acute health services to the local population of approximately 160,000 people.
The Princess of Wales Hospital is one of the most modern hospitals in Wales. The hospital provides a comprehensive range of acute surgery and medicine for patients of all ages, including inpatient, outpatient and day services. Although predominantly serving patients in the local area, the Princess of Wales Hospital provides some specialist Treatment Centres for patients throughout Wales, and in the case of the Pulsed Dye Laser and Cochlear Implant Programme, for patients much further afield.
